概括
这项研究介绍了MSFT-Transformer,这是一种新型的人工智能模型,集成了各种元基因组数据,以改进人类疾病预测. 它增强了对人类微生物群的理解.
科学领域:
- 微生物组研究的研究.
- 生物信息学是一种生物信息学.
- 计算生物学是一种计算生物学.
背景情况:
- 人类微生物组在健康和疾病中起着至关重要的作用.
- 超基因组测序产生了庞大的,复杂的数据集 (分类学和功能资料).
- 目前的方法通常不充分利用元基因组数据的全部潜力,因为它们依赖单一的信息类型.
研究的目的:
- 开发一种新的架构,有效地整合多样化,高维度的元基因组数据.
- 改进用于疾病相关性发现的元基因组信息的利用.
- 通过使用全面的微生物组数据,提高疾病预测的准确性.
主要方法:
- 提出了一个多阶段的融合表格式变压器架构 (MSFT-Transformer).
- 采用了三个模块的融合策略:融合意识的特征提取,对齐增强的融合和集成的特征决策.
- 对五个标准元基因组数据集的最新模型进行性能评估.
主要成果:
- 与现有模型相比,MSFT-Transformer表现出稳定的业绩增长.
- 拟议的模型在降低计算成本的情况下实现了这些收益.
- 一项废弃研究证实了新型聚变模块的重大贡献.
结论:
- 该MSFT-变压器有效地集成多种类型的元基因组数据.
- 这种方法为更准确的疾病预测提供了一个有希望的途径.
- 该模型具有显著的潜力,可用于微生物组基础诊断的未来应用.
